First things first, know your audience. Understanding who you’re speaking to is crucial. Are they millennials with a penchant for pastel aesthetics, or perhaps professionals drawn to sleek, minimalist designs? Tailor your visuals to resonate with your target demographic. This will make your storytelling feel personal and relevant.
Next up, consistency is key. Imagine walking into a room where the walls are painted every color of the rainbow—it’s a bit jarring, right? The same goes for your website. Ensure a cohesive theme and style throughout your pages. Consistent color schemes, fonts, and imagery types not only make your site look polished but also reinforce your brand identity. Another tip: don’t underestimate the power of simplicity. In the world of web design, sometimes less is indeed more. Focus on uncluttered designs that allow your visuals to shine. Now, let’s talk about movement. Incorporating animations can add a dynamic element to your storytelling, captivating your audience’s attention. Whether it’s a subtle hover effect or a bold interactive animation, these elements can guide the user’s journey through your site.
